Power 2 Align the Safety Reversing Sensors IMPORTANT: The safety reversing sensors MUST be connected and aligned correctly before the garage door opener will move in the down direction. When the garage door opener has power, check the safety reversing sensors. If the sensors are aligned and wired correctly, both LEDs will glow steadily. SAFETY SENSOR TROUBLESHOOTING If either of the sensor LEDs are off, there is no power to the sensor: 1. Check that you have power to the garage door opener. 2. Check the sensor wire is not shorted or broken. 3. Check that the sensors are wired correctly; white wires to white terminal and white/black wires to grey terminal. 1 2 3 Light Beam Protection Area RED WHITE WHITE GREY Sending sensor - amber LED Receiving sensor - green LED The receiving sensor has a sticker on the back. To align the safety reversing sensors: 1. Loosen the wing nuts. 2. Adjust the sensors up or down until both LEDs glow steady indicating alignment. 3. Tighten the wing nut to secure the sensor. If the green receiving sensor LED is blinking, the sensors are obstructed or misaligned: 1. Check for obstructions in the sensor light beam. 2. Align the sensors. 3. If the receiving sensor (green LED) faces direct sunlight, switch the receiving sensor with the sending sensor and repeat 1 Install the Safety Reversing Sensors page 20 to assure proper operation. 3 Ensure the Control Panel is Wired Correctly If the control panel has been installed and wired correctly, the command LED behind the push bar will blink.
